On the large yellow house’s metal door is an artwork by the Swedish graffiti artist Ziggy. The color scale is in white, gray, black, and pink and presents a made-up alphabet. For this piece, Ziggy exposes his inner self for us to look at. With the made-up written language, he writes down his secrets in several layers with different colors. The bottom layer contains the most secret and everything, according to Ziggy, is decipherable.
Ziggy is a pioneer within the Swedish world of graffiti and was one of the first graffiti artists in Stockholm and Sweden. He was also part of the famous movie “Stockhomsnatt” (Stockholm Night) from 1987 and is a role model for many of today’s graffiti artists.
